Geum calthifolium (commonly known as Caltha-Leaved Avens or Calthaleaf Avens) is a herbaceous perennial within the Rosaceae family. It is found natively in Temperate Asia and North America. Within its native range, this species is most commonly linked to temperate conditions. There are naturally occurring varieties of this species, which are linked below.

Native Range
Continents (WGSRPD)
ASIA-TEMPERATE, NORTHERN AMERICA
Regions (WGSRPD)
Eastern Asia, Russian Far East, Subarctic America, Western Canada
Botanical Countries (WGSRPD L3)
Alaska, British Columbia, Japan, Kamchatka, Kuril Is., Magadan, Sakhalin
